Section 72

Cognizance of offences by Judge

(a)

upon receiving a complaint as defined by this Act;

(b)

upon his own knowledge and with evidence to support that such offence has been committed;

(c)

upon any person being brought before him in custody without process accused of having committed an offence which such Judge has jurisdiction to try.

(2)

When a Judge takes cognizance of an offence under paragraph (1)(b), the accused or, when there are several persons accused, any one of them shall be entitled to require that the case shall not be tried by such Judge but shall be tried by another

Judge.
